Mesmerizing Monsoon with Jaypee Residency Manor, Mussorie, India
Sipping a hot cup of coffee nestled in the hills with your loved ones while it pours outside exemplifies tranquility and joy. Make that moment your own as the much awaited monsoons are finally here and Jaypee Residency Manor gives you a reason to escape to the hills for the pristine getaway. So instead of …